Buyer Guide For Dog Bed
Finding the right dog bed is essential for your pets well-being. Here are some important considerations:Size
- Measure your dog to ensure the bed is the right size.
- Consider the space where the bed will be placed.
- Choose a bed that allows your dog to stretch out comfortably.
Material
- Look for durable, chew-resistant materials.
- Opt for beds with removable, washable covers.
- Consider orthopedic foam for older dogs or those with joint issues.
Shape
- Rectangular beds are ideal for dogs that like to lie flat.
- Round beds are perfect for dogs that curl up.
- Bolster beds offer additional support and comfort.
Support
- Ensure the bed provides adequate support for your dogs weight.
- Memory foam or high-density foam beds are excellent choices.
- Elevated beds can help keep your dog cool and comfortable.
Additional Features
- Waterproof liners protect the bed from spills.
- Non-slip bottoms keep the bed in place.
- Removable covers make cleaning the bed easier.

How to maintain Dog Bed
Maintaining a dog bed is essential for your pets health and comfort. Here are some steps to ensure the bed remains clean and durable.Cleaning Frequency
- Clean the bed cover weekly and the entire bed monthly.
- Use mild, pet-safe detergents to avoid skin irritations.
- Regular vacuuming helps remove hair and dirt.
Material Care
- Follow the care instructions provided by the manufacturer.
- Spot clean memory foam beds to avoid water damage.
- Use a lint roller to remove hair from non-washable parts.
Odor Control
- Apply baking soda to the bed before vacuuming to neutralize odors.
- Use pet-safe fabric sprays for a fresh scent.
- Ensure the bed is thoroughly dry after washing to prevent mold.
Protection
- Use a waterproof cover to protect against accidents.
- Keep the bed in a dry, shaded area to prevent sun damage.
- Rotate the bed regularly to ensure even wear.
Inspection
- Regularly check for signs of damage, such as holes or flattened areas.
- Replace the bed if it no longer provides adequate support.
- Ensure zippers and seams are intact to maintain the beds integrity.
